Medical Billing Supervisor oversees the preparation of medical bills and invoices, the calculation of provider charges, and verification of patient insurance. Maintains insurance documents and contracts. Being a Medical Billing Supervisor oversees the submission of claim reports and filing procedures. Ensures billing operations are performed in an accurate and timely manner. Additionally, Medical Billing Supervisor evaluates billing processes and procedures and assists management in developing revisions. Monitors the revenue cycle activities and resolves any issues. Needs to be familiar with ICD-10, CPT, and/or HCPCS Coding Systems as well as claim forms such as CMS-1500 and UB-04. Requires a high school diploma or its equivalent. Typically reports to a manager. The Medical Billing Supervisor supervises a small group of para-professional staff in an organization characterized by highly transactional or repetitive processes. Contributes to the development of processes and procedures. Thorough knowledge of functional area under supervision. To be a Medical Billing Supervisor typically requires 3 years experience in the related area as an individual contributor. (Copyright 2024 Salary.com)
